Silver Gull Outdoors is a family-owned Muskoka outfitter operating from Rotary Park on Gull Lake in Gravenhurst, about 1.5 hours north of the Greater Toronto Area off Highway 11. Guided tours and rentals open Friday, May 15, 2026, with sunset paddles on Gull Lake, hourly kayak, stand-up paddleboard, canoe, and pack-raft rentals, and a year-round catalogue of Outdoor Council of Canada certificate courses — including Field Leader Hiking, Paddling, Overnight, and Winter modules. As a licenced OCC provider, Silver Gull pairs traditional Indigenous paddle and snow technologies with modern safety practice, and structures its offerings to reduce financial, emotional, and physical barriers to getting outside.

    Field Leader Hiking/Paddling & Overnight

    For: Aspiring or current outdoor leaders proficient in day hiking, calm-water paddling, and backcountry camping (not a learn-to-camp course)When: Starts May 28, 2026 — 5 calendar days across May and June

    A 40-hour Outdoor Council of Canada course delivering up to three Field Leader certificates — Hiking, Paddling, and Overnight — plus a one-year OCC membership. Two evening online sessions are followed by a full field day, then a three-day backcountry overnight. Paddling certification requires Paddle Canada or ORCKA skills proof including rescues. Meal plan and gear rentals are optional add-ons.
